Francesca Coppa is a scholar working on Sociology and Political Science, Visual Arts and Performing Arts and Literature and Literary Theory. According to data from OpenAlex, Francesca Coppa has authored 21 papers receiving a total of 185 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Sociology and Political Science, 6 papers in Visual Arts and Performing Arts and 4 papers in Literature and Literary Theory. Recurrent topics in Francesca Coppa's work include Digital Games and Media (7 papers), Cinema and Media Studies (3 papers) and Theatre and Performance Studies (2 papers). Francesca Coppa is often cited by papers focused on Digital Games and Media (7 papers), Cinema and Media Studies (3 papers) and Theatre and Performance Studies (2 papers). Francesca Coppa collaborates with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and Italy. Francesca Coppa's co-authors include Rebecca Tushnet, John Stokes, Kristina Busse, Sarah Banet‐Weiser, Beatrice Belmonte, Fabio Bertoldo, Lincoln Geraghty, Amedeo Ferlosio, Calogera Pisano and Maria Giovanna Scioli and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, International Journal of Molecular Sciences and Cinema Journal.
